Legislative Research Department and Revisor's Office staff introduced themselves and described which agency budgets they will staff for the Senate Ways and Means Committee; staff said they are available to answer questions and route inquiries during the session.

The Senate Ways and Means Committee began its session with staff introductions from the Legislative Research Department (KLRD) and the Revisor's Office, during which analysts listed the agency budgets they will cover this legislative session and offered contact availability.

"Thank Mr. Chairman, David Weese with the Revisor's Office. So we are the bill drafters of course. We are, Jesse and I will be staffing again. We've been doing the ways and means for a few years now," said David Weese of the Revisor's Office, who also invited members to come to him or Jesse for bill requests and proviso language.
